Online Petition about the Active Reserves Plan 

Priority One, Tauranga City Council and the Commissioners have been quietly developing the Active Reserves Plan which rearranges and deletes sports and amenities at Tauranga Domain (to build a stadium), Blake Park and the Baypark Arena.  At the end of this expensive reshuffle, Tauranga will be left with no new amenities at all and the destruction of the Speedway, Athletics Track, Bowling Club, Croquet Club, sports halls at Mt Maunganui and sports clubs which may not be replaced.  The total cost of this plan may exceed $500 million.

NOTE: The Council does not propose to put the athletics track in the same space at Baypark Arena from where Speedway is being evicted from.
